Address 7.40778908 DOGE

DJhWWktxeghk53K3sAgfkLSz1FHmuxryN5

Confirmed

Total Received7.40778908 DOGE
Total Sent0 DOGE
Final Balance7.40778908 DOGE
No. Transactions1

Transactions